What is Belt Press Filter Cloth?


Belt press filter cloth is a specialized textile designed for use in **belt filter presses**, which are essential equipment in wastewater treatment facilities. This cloth acts as a barrier that separates solid particulates from liquids as the wastewater is processed. The design of the belt ensures optimal flow and retention of solids, leading to effective dewatering and clarification.

Applications of Belt Press Filter Cloth


Belt press filter cloths are versatile and are used across various industries and applications, including:
- **Municipal Wastewater Treatment**: Used to process sewage and industrial effluents, ensuring that contaminants are effectively removed.
- **Food and Beverage Industry**: Applied in the processing of food waste and wastewater from production facilities.
- **Mining and Mineral Processing**: Effective in dewatering slurries and tailings, allowing for the recovery of valuable minerals.
- **Pulp and Paper Industry**: Utilized in the treatment of wastewater generated during the production of paper products.

Selection Criteria for Belt Press Filter Cloth


Choosing the right belt press filter cloth is crucial for optimizing performance. Here are key factors to consider:
 

Material Types


Different materials, such as polyester, polypropylene, and nylon, offer various levels of durability and filtration efficiency. Polyester is commonly used due to its balance of strength and flexibility, while polypropylene is preferred for applications requiring chemical resistance.
 

Fabric Design


The design of the fabric, including weave type and pore size, influences filtration efficiency. A tighter weave can retain smaller particles, while a looser weave allows for greater flow rates. Evaluate the specific requirements of your application to determine the best design.
 

Size and Thickness


The size and thickness of the filter cloth must match the dimensions of the belt filter press and the type of sludge being processed. A thicker cloth may provide better durability, but it could also impede flow rates if not matched correctly.
 

Maintenance and Care for Belt Press Filter Cloth


Proper maintenance of belt press filter cloth is essential for longevity and performance. Here are some best practices:
1. **Regular Cleaning**: Clean the cloth regularly to prevent clogging and ensure optimal flow.
2. **Inspection**: Check for wear and tear, particularly at seams and edges, to identify when replacement is necessary.
3. **Storage**: Store cloths in a clean, dry environment to prevent degradation from moisture or chemicals.

FAQs About Belt Press Filter Cloth in Wastewater Treatment


**1. What is the lifespan of belt press filter cloth?** 
The lifespan can vary based on material and usage, but typically, high-quality cloths last between 1-5 years with proper maintenance.
**2. How often should filter cloths be replaced?** 
Replacement frequency depends on wear and operational conditions. Regular inspections can help determine the right timing for replacement.
**3. Can belt press filter cloth be cleaned?** 
Yes, most filter cloths can be cleaned using water or specific cleaning agents to remove buildup and extend their operating life.
**4. What factors influence the choice of filter cloth material?** 
Key factors include the type of wastewater, temperature, and chemical composition of the effluent being treated.
**5. Are there custom options for belt press filter cloth?** 
Yes, many manufacturers offer custom designs to fit specific operational needs, including size, thickness, and material type.
